OpenVAS Client for Linux is a powerful, free network security tool designed for vulnerability scanning and management. This utility enables users to conduct comprehensive security assessments, helping to identify potential vulnerabilities in their systems. It features a user-friendly interface that simplifies the process of configuring scans, reviewing results, and managing vulnerabilities effectively.

The OpenVAS Client integrates seamlessly with the OpenVAS vulnerability assessment framework, allowing users to schedule scans, generate detailed reports, and track remediation efforts. It supports a wide range of network protocols and can be utilized in various environments, making it a versatile choice for system administrators and security professionals. With its extensive plugin library, users can keep their scans up to date with the latest security checks.
